Determinants of logistics service supplier choice for electronics exporters: Evidence from an emerging market

Abstract: This study aims to explore important factors influencing the decision-making process in selecting logistics service suppliers by electronic component export companies in Vietnam, with a particular focus on local service providers (LSPs). The research involved in-depth interviews with eight logistics experts and a quantitative survey of 300 representatives from electronic component export companies. Data was collected through online surveys, then analyzed using the SEM model. The findings indicate that six key factors influence the decision-making process. Among them, cost competitiveness, the reputation of logistics suppliers, and service quality directly affect the selection of logistics services, while management capabilities, technical and information processing skills, and the pursuit of sustainable development have indirect effects. These results offer useful insights for LSPs, enabling them to align their services with the specific needs of electronic component exporters and improve their market competitiveness.
